With a stay at In The Brick Spa & Hotel, you'll be centrally located in Melbourne, within a 10-minute drive of Melbourne Cricket Ground and Rod Laver Arena. This spa hotel is 3.1 mi (5 km) from Crown Casino and 3.5 mi (5.6 km) from Collins Street.
Pamper yourself with a visit to the spa, which offers massages, body treatments, and facials. Additional features at this hotel include complimentary wireless internet access and concierge services.
The front desk is staffed during limited hours. Free self parking is available onsite.
Make yourself at home in one of the 5 air-conditioned rooms featuring flat-screen televisions. Complimentary wireless internet access is available to keep you connected. Conveniences include desks and electric kettles, as well as phones with free local calls.
